The eufy Security eufyCam S3 Pro 4-Cam Kit is a strong choice for outdoor HomeKit users seeking high-quality video and reliable power options. It offers impressive 4K resolution for very detailed footage, although video shown through HomeKit is limited to 1080p. The cameras have a wide 135-degree field of view, capturing a broad area to reduce blind spots. Night vision is enhanced by the MaxColor Vision technology, which provides clear, color-rich images even in very low light without needing extra spotlights, making it easier to identify details at night.
Motion detection is advanced, using both radar and infrared sensors to accurately detect human movement and cut down false alarms by up to 99%, so you’re alerted only when it really matters. Storage is flexible and privacy-friendly, with 16GB onboard and support for up to 16TB of local expandable storage, meaning no monthly fees for cloud services. This is great for those wanting to keep footage private and accessible without ongoing costs. Power-wise, the system is battery-operated and supported by a reliable SolarPlus 2.0 solar power system, which includes backup solar panels to help keep the cameras charged continuously, reducing maintenance.
Integration with Apple HomeKit is supported, along with Alexa and other voice assistants, making it convenient to control via smartphone or voice commands. The eufyCam S3 Pro kit suits users who want high-resolution, day-like night vision, smart motion detection, and flexible, no-fee storage, especially if solar-powered outdoor cameras fit their setup. The lower resolution when streaming through HomeKit might be a consideration depending on individual needs.
The eufy Indoor Cam E30 is a high-resolution 4K UHD security camera featuring a range of advanced functionalities suited for indoor use. Its standout features include 4K ultra-clear recording, which ensures superior image clarity, and color night vision with a built-in spotlight that enhances visibility in low-light conditions. The 360° panoramic view and AI-powered detection with smart auto tracking make it easy to monitor your entire space and receive alerts for specific activities like human or pet movement.
The two-way audio allows real-time communication, making it a great choice for staying connected with family or pets. It integrates seamlessly with HomeKit, Alexa, and Google Assistant, though HomeKit users should note it supports up to 1080P resolution with that platform. For storage, the camera offers local storage via an SD card and optional cloud storage, avoiding mandatory subscription fees, which is a notable advantage.
However, it needs to be plugged in as it relies on a corded electric power source, which might limit placement flexibility. Additionally, the frame rate is 15 frames per second, which is lower compared to some alternatives in the market. The camera is easy to set up and operate through the Eufy app, providing a user-friendly experience. For anyone prioritizing high-quality video resolution, advanced motion tracking, and integration with smart home systems, this camera is a robust option.
The Arlo Ultra 2 Spotlight Camera is a strong choice for outdoor home security, offering sharp 4K HDR video which helps capture clear details like faces or license plates. Its ultra-wide 180-degree field of view covers a large area, reducing blind spots. Color night vision is a valuable feature if you want to see more than just black and white footage at night. Two-way audio lets you listen and speak through the camera, useful for interacting with visitors or deterring intruders.
This system requires the included SmartHub to function and connects via dual-band Wi-Fi (2.4GHz and 5GHz), which helps maintain a stable connection. It uses rechargeable batteries, allowing flexible placement without worrying about wiring, though you’ll need to remember to recharge them. Motion detection is active and triggers alerts through the app, though advanced features like person or vehicle recognition require a paid Arlo Secure subscription. The camera integrates with Apple HomeKit, Amazon Alexa, and Google Home, making it convenient if you already use these smart home platforms. Storage options include cloud storage through subscription plans, as the system doesn’t provide local storage by default.
The reliance on a paid subscription for full functionality and extended video storage might be a drawback for some users. Also, while 4K video is excellent for detail, streaming and storage can consume significant bandwidth and space. The system is weather resistant (IP65), making it suitable for outdoor use but not fully waterproof for extreme conditions. For those seeking a feature-rich, high-resolution outdoor camera that works smoothly with HomeKit and other smart platforms and don’t mind a subscription for advanced features, the Arlo Ultra 2 represents a reliable option. However, if you prefer simpler setups without ongoing fees, other models might be more suitable.
